II.2.4) Description of the procurement
CVG wishes to employ a suitable contractor to provide an annual maintenance and servicing regime and 24 hour a day 365 days a year reactive repairs and maintenance service to existing fire safety assets within properties located throughout North Lanarkshire, South Lanarkshire, East Dunbartonshire and Glasgow to comply with cyclical appliance asset management. This procurement will be on a 60% Quality and 40% Price.
The Contract duration is three years (thirty-six months) from the commencement date of 1 October 2026 until 30 September 2029, and will primarily include maintenance, servicing and repairs, ensuring all properties are compliant with current and future regulations

III.1.1) Suitability to pursue the professional activity, including requirements relating to enrolment on professional or trade registers
List and brief description of conditions
The minimum accreditations required to bid for this contract are equal to or similar to:
-BAFE SP203-1 Design, Installation, Commission and Maintenance of Fire Detection and Fire Alarm Systems Scheme.
-BAFE SP203-4 Design, Installation, Commission and Maintenance of Emergency Lighting Systems Scheme.
-BAFE SP105 Competency of Organisations for the Service and Maintenance of Dry and Wet Riser/Falling Installations Scheme.
-Sprinkler Systems Accreditation from approved body such as Loss Prevention Certificate Board (LPS 1301), Warrington Schemes (Firas), or IFC Certification scheme (SDI 122).
-Member of Smoke Control Association (SCA) with accreditation from IF Certification Ltd (SDI 19 Scheme).
-Select, NICEIC or ECA Membership.
